In today's fast-paced world, the concept of an attention interrupt has become increasingly relevant. We live in an age where distractions are everywhere, from our smartphones buzzing with notifications to the constant barrage of information on social media. An attention interrupt refers to any stimulus that diverts our focus away from the task at hand. This can be as simple as a text message or as complex as the overwhelming amount of content available online. Understanding how attention interrupts affect our productivity and mental health is crucial for navigating modern life.When we experience an attention interrupt, our brains must shift gears, which can lead to a decrease in efficiency. Research has shown that it takes time to regain focus after being interrupted. For instance, if you are working on a project and receive a notification, it may take several minutes to return to your previous level of concentration. This phenomenon illustrates why minimizing attention interrupts is essential for maintaining productivity.Moreover, the impact of attention interrupts extends beyond mere productivity. Frequent interruptions can lead to increased stress and anxiety levels. When we are constantly pulled in different directions, it becomes challenging to manage our time effectively. This can create a sense of chaos in our lives, making it difficult to find moments of peace and clarity. By recognizing the role of attention interrupts in our daily routines, we can take proactive steps to mitigate their effects.One effective strategy for reducing attention interrupts is to establish designated times for checking messages and notifications. By setting boundaries around our digital consumption, we can create a more focused environment. Additionally, practicing mindfulness techniques can help train our minds to resist distractions. Techniques such as meditation or deep-breathing exercises can enhance our ability to concentrate and minimize the influence of attention interrupts.In educational settings, attention interrupts pose significant challenges for both students and teachers. In classrooms filled with technology, it is easy for students to become distracted by their devices. Educators can combat this by fostering a supportive environment that encourages engagement and focus. Implementing rules around device usage during lessons can help minimize attention interrupts and promote a more productive learning atmosphere.In conclusion, the phenomenon of attention interrupts is a critical factor in our ability to focus and achieve our goals. By understanding what constitutes an attention interrupt and actively working to reduce its occurrence, we can improve our productivity and overall well-being. As we continue to navigate a world filled with distractions, it is essential to prioritize our attention and create strategies that foster sustained focus and clarity. Ultimately, mastering the art of managing attention interrupts will lead us to greater success in both our personal and professional lives.
